- ベストアンサー
JavaからMySQLにアクセスする方法
- JavaからMysqlにアクセスするための設定方法について調査しているが、ClassNotFoundExceptionが発生している。
- mysql-connector-javaを設定することで問題が解決するとされているが、実行ダイアログが表示されないため、設定方法が不明。
- ClassPathを通す方法やWEB-INF/LIBにファイルを配置する方法を試したがうまくいかない。初心者のため、具体的な手順を説明してほしい。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
- ベストアンサー
こんにちは。 yotarouさんもリンク先の通りeclipseで開発されていると思うのですがバージョンはどれでしょうか? リンク先の記事は2005年と古く、eclipseのバージョンも古い為に現在のeclipseとは見た目が変わっているのでわからなかったのかと思います。 ちなみに現在のeclipseの最新バージョンは3.5でして、3.5でのeclipseのクラスパスの設定方法は、 eclipseの左側にあるパッケージ一覧から設定したいプロジェクトを右クリックし「プロパティー」をクリック→「Javaのビルド・パス」を選択→「ライブラリー」を選択→「外部JARの追加」をクリックし表示されるウインドウにてmysql-connector-javaのJARを選択する で設定できると思います。 ただ質問の内容から基本知識が不足しているように感じますので、早く何かを作りたいという気持ちもありますでしょうが、基礎知識こそ本当に大切だと思うので基礎を固めることをオススメします。 僕の知る範囲では、本ですと結城さんの入門書の上下巻あたりが。 http://www.amazon.co.jp/%E6%94%B9%E8%A8%82%E7%AC%AC2%E7%89%88-Java%E8%A8%80%E8%AA%9E%E3%83%97%E3%83%AD%E3%82%B0%E3%83%A9%E3%83%9F%E3%83%B3%E3%82%B0%E3%83%AC%E3%83%83%E3%82%B9%E3%83%B3-%E4%B8%8A-%E7%B5%90%E5%9F%8E-%E6%B5%A9/dp/4797332115/ref=sr_1_5?ie=UTF8&s=books&qid=1260448373&sr=8-5 サイトですと下記のサイトあたりがオススメかと思います。 http://www.javaroad.jp/index.htm
お礼
丁寧な解説ありがとうございます。ご指摘のように基本的知識の不足とあせりがあります。全体の構造が見えていないために苦戦しているのは自分でも良く分かります。 今の理解は、JAVACでコンパイルして実行クラスを作るこれが基本なのかなと考えています。一方でオブジェクト指向によると沢山のプログラム或いは共通のモジュールを関係つける必要がある。これを簡素化するツールとしてEclipseがあるということなのかなと理解しました。 あまたの要素があって、それを組み合わせるのがWebで動くシステムなのかなと感じます。